Superb mid-century coffee table. The top is composed of terracotta-colored fired lava stone tiles and ceramic tiles. The base is made of steel.
Jean Jaffeux (1931-2015) was a French ceramicist and painter, specializing in enameling on lava stone. For over fifty years, he created decorative works and monumental commissions for churches, public buildings, and private clients. His work, often featuring abstract or nature-inspired motifs, helped to popularize the art of enameled lava in France and throughout the world.
His coffee tables, along with those made from other materials, are in the tradition of the coffee tables of Roger Capron and Vallauris.
